Beric Schwartzhaupt of Hanau, Germany, was arrested in San Diego as authorities seized 12 kilograms of pure steroid worth $1.9 million, officials said.

Schwartzhaupt will be charged with importing and distributing a controlled substance, California Attorney General Dan Lungren said.

Schwartzhaupt was arrested after he received from Germany the 12-kilogram shipment of steroids, enough to fill--when diluted--24,000 bottles of 100 tablets each, worth $80 a bottle on the street, Lungren said.
